
Sunflowers in Honey Whiskey Retro Illustration by Retrodrome
A honey whiskey bottle becomes an impromptu vase, sunflowers bursting from its neck in vivid amber and golden yellow. Retrodrome works in the Bauhaus tradition of functional beauty — strong geometric outlines, flat colour, and a deliberate economy of line that gives the image an almost typographic weight. The warm palette draws directly from the subject matter, whiskey amber and sunflower gold locked in perfect harmony. The mood is celebratory and unambiguous, a piece that understands exactly what it wants to say and says it with confidence.
